How much do amazon bioinformatics jobs pay per year?

As of Jul 16, 2026, the average yearly pay for amazon bioinformatics in the United States is $94,474.00, according to ZipRecruiter salary data. Most workers in this role earn between $67,500.00 and $129,500.00 per year, depending on experience, location, and employer.

What is an Amazon Bioinformatics job?

An Amazon Bioinformatics job involves applying computational and statistical techniques to analyze biological data, often in support of Amazon's healthcare, life sciences, or agritech initiatives. Professionals in this role work with large datasets, develop algorithms, and use machine learning to derive insights from genomic, proteomic, or other biological information. They collaborate with scientists, engineers, and product teams to develop innovative solutions for personalized medicine, drug discovery, or agricultural optimization.

The University of California, San Francisco is seeking a Bioinformatics Programmer to join the bioinformatics team supporting the Clinical Cancer Genomics Laboratory (CCGL), the Genomic Medicine Laboratory (GML), and the Institute for Human Genetics Sequencing Core (IHG Core).
Responsibilities for CCGL:
In this role, this individual will be part of a bioinformatics team responsible for design, construction, and maintenance of a genomic analysis pipeline supporting the UCSF500 Cancer Gene Panel assay, a molecular test profiling DNA from tumor and normal tissue to identify mutations that may drive a patient's cancer and aid in diagnosis and treatment, and a related RNAseq pipeline to identify gene fusions. Our internally developed cloud-based genomic analysis pipelines detect single nucleotide variants, small and medium indels, structural rearrangements, copy number variants, and microsatellite instability, and communicate with sequencing core services, laboratory information management systems and clinical reporting software.
Under the general direction of the Associate Director of Bioinformatics for the Clinical Cancer Genomics Laboratory, the Bioinformatics Programmer will design and develop new components and pipelines to support new and enhanced clinical testing. New features slated for development include tumor methylation- and whole transcriptome-based classifiers and AI tools to assist in clinical signout. Other new software developed will provide support for automating aspects of sample analysis and error reporting and integration with other clinical systems. Additional responsibilities will include supporting the development of new target capture panels and test validation as well as quarterly data analysis to improve QC and support clinical annotation. In this role, the Bioinformatics Programmer will interface with molecular pathologists, laboratory and administrative staff, medical researchers, technical teams for related clinical systems and data repositories, and research consortia.
Responsibilities for GML:
The individual will be part of the bioinformatics team responsible for building and maintaining pipelines to support genomic analysis for the clinical tests performed by GML including: Rapid Whole Genome Sequencing, Exome Sequencing, Hereditary Cancer Panel, and exome subpanels. New features slated for development include long-read sequencing platforms to complement existing short-read whole genome sequencing. The individual will build infrastructure to route data to, from, and between numerous 3rd party platforms, kick off appropriate analyses, and manage data storage. New pipelines will also be built to support auto verification of negative cases, QC analyses, and retrospective studies. The individual will also perform ad hoc analyses and processing of clinical data to support lab initiatives and special cases that must be handled outside of the standard pipelines.
Responsibilities for IHG Core:
The individual will work as part of the bioinformatics team responsible for building and maintaining an end-to-end automated pipeline to transport raw sequencing data from sequencing machines to UCSF Amazon Web Services Secure Enterprise Cloud, convert raw sequencing data to sequencing reads, route clinical data to downstream systems, perform individual analyses for custom research projects, return data to customers, and manage data storage.
